The equation of a parabola having its focus at S(2,0) and one extremity of its latus rectum as (2,2) isA. `y^(2)=4(3-x)`B. `y^(2)=4(1-x)`C. `y^(2)=4(1-x)`D. `y^(2)=8(3-x)` |
|
Answer» Clearly, the other extremity of the latus rectum is (2,-2). It axis is the x-axis. Corresponding value of `a=(2-0)/(2)=1` Hence, its vertex is (1,0) or (3,0). Thus, its equation is `y^(2)=4(x-1)` or `y^(2)=-4(x-3)`. |
